Codes & Zoning Enforcement

The Borough of Mechanicsburg has a full-time Codes and Zoning Department. The Codes and Zoning Department of the Borough collects, processes and issues all Building, Zoning Permits and Historic Architectural Review Board Applications. This department is also responsible for the enforcement of the Residential Rental Inspection Ordinance.

ZONING PERMITS

Zoning permits are required for all change of uses at a property, adding space to an existing structure or adding fences or accessory structures.  Zoning permits are also required for changes to the hardscape coverage on your property.

BUILDING PERMITS

Building Permits are required for owners or authorized agents who intend to construct, enlarge, alter, repair, move, demolish or change the occupancy of a commercial or residential building, structure and facility or to erect, install, enlarge, alter, repair, remove, convert or replace any electrical, gas, mechanical, or plumbing equipment or system in the Mechanicsburg Borough. If an emergency repair is required outside of the normal operating hours of the Borough the work can proceed, but the next day that the Borough office is open a Building Permit shall be filed, examples of emergency repairs- roof leak, plumbing leak, appliance replacement, etc. Whether property owner or a contractor will be performing the work, the property owner is responsible for securing the permit.

Note: An emergency repair is only one that would negatively impact the safety or health of a buildings occupants or the general public and absolutely cannot wait until the Borough office is open in order to file the permit.

Failure to obtain proper permitting before work commences will result in citations being filed against the property owner and/or the builder. The fines for working without a building permit are a maximum of $1,000.00 per day that the violation exists and up to 30 days imprisonment. The Building Code is in place to protect our residents and violators of this Code will be cited.

HISTORIC ARCHITECTURAL REVIEW BOARD
In order to maintain historical value of the town a Historical Architectural Review Board (HARB) was created to maximize efforts to retain original features of our historical buildings.  As a result, areas of the town were set apart as “Historical” which require an additional level of review when new work is being proposed to the outside of the structure.
